Scan overnight reports for broken pipelines or missing data feeds.
Sync with analysts and IT. Flag blocked queries, confirm today's priorities.
Hunt down duplicate records and null values before any analysis can start.
Write queries against the EHR database to pull last quarter's readmission records.
Spike in ER wait times looks alarming — real trend or a data entry glitch?
Wire new quality-score metrics into the clinical team's live Tableau dashboard.
Translate the readmission findings into plain language for the nursing director.
Check that the shared report can't be reverse-engineered to identify any patient.
Package weekly hospital cost, wait-time, and quality scores; send to leadership.

Data Analysts serve as the bridge between raw data and business insights, helping organizations understand their performance, identify trends, and make data-driven decisions. They focus on interpreting existing data to support operational and strategic business objectives.
Biostatisticians apply statistical methods to analyze data in biological, medical, and health-related fields. They play a crucial role in designing studies, interpreting results, and helping advance medical research and public health initiatives through rigorous data analysis and evidence-based insights.
Data Scientists are the detectives of the digital world, uncovering hidden patterns and insights from complex datasets to help organizations make informed decisions. They combine statistical analysis, programming, and business acumen to transform raw data into actionable intelligence.
